Chilean long-fibre sphagnum 300 g
Chilean long-fibre sphagnum up to 15 cm, sustainably harvested. 300 g yields 10–12 litres.
Chilean long-fibre sphagnum — up to fifteen centimetres — the same grade we root our cuttings in. The long fibre is not a nicety: short fibre packs down, settles on the bottom and suffocates roots, while this stays open even when wet.
It is naturally antifungal and holds a quantity of water out of all proportion to its weight, which makes it irreplaceable for two jobs — rooting cuttings and filling moss poles. On a delicate root system, being antifungal matters more than the absorbency does.
Three hundred dry grams look like very little until you wet them: rehydrated, they become ten to twelve litres.

How to use it
Soak it before use and wring it out well: it should be damp, not dripping. Wrap it round the node of a cutting or around aerial roots, or use it to fill a moss pole — in self-watering setups it beats the mix, because it holds a steadier moisture. Store it dry and sealed: left damp in the bag it goes mouldy.
